
Kate Hansen Bundt
Kate Hansen Bundt is the Secretary General of the Norwegian Atlantic Committee, an organization focused on promoting transatlantic relations and security cooperation. With a strong background in German politics, she offers insights into the dynamics of the Alternative for Germany (AfD) party and its potential influence on future elections in Germany and the European Union.
